On the south-west corner of the Tikehau Atoll, lies an 18 acre private island of white sand and coral, where this stunning new Resort hides away. Designed to take great advantage of the beautiful lagoon, the Ninamu Resort caters to anyone who loves the water, either cruising, surfing or floating on the surface, or diving or snorkelling under it!
Offering just 8 private bungalows, accommodating just 20 guests in total, the Resort is small and personal, and an ideal, back-to-nature, retreat from the hectic pace of life.
The 8 individually-named, thatched bungalows are all hand built and crafted from natural, locally sourced materials, and are all different in construction, each using which ever shape of tree or driftwood they had to hand, to influence the design. They offer 1, 2 or 3 bedrooms but each has a different layout. Some have mezzanine levels with sitting or bedroom areas, others have open air sitting rooms overlooking the gardens or the beach. Each of the Bungalows are alongside the path through the trees, with 3 right on the beach, and 3 amongst the lush garden landscaping. Each have king or queen size beds with mosquito nets, ensuite bathroom, sitting area (some with pull out sofa beds), ceiling fans and furnished sun deck. 2 of the bungalows have 2 or 3 separate bedrooms, making them ideal for families or groups of friends to share.
The main building houses the restaurant, bar, and lounge area, for guests to relax and mingle, if you wish. The restaurant serves a daily buffet featuring fresh fish and seafood, usually caught not too far away, as well as local fruit and vegetables, grown on an organic farm on another nearby atoll called Eden Island, and free-range meat and poultry. Fresh bread is baked daily The Resort is almost all-inclusive, as all food, snacks, tea and coffee are included, just the drinks are charged for.
There are many free activities at Ninamu, including some instruction and free use of all the watersports equipment, such as kayaks, jet ski, kiteboarding, surfing, snorkelling and paddles. Deep sea fishing is also available, with a local charge. Free Wi-Fi internet access is also available in the restaurant and lounge area.
The Ninamu Resort is a very 'green' resort, and has installed solar panels to provide all their energy needs and to heat all the hot water. The rain water is captured in tanks to provide drinking water and a well provides ground water for grey-water purposes, such as toilets.
The Ninamu Resort is not a high-end luxury resort, but a natural, individual property, with a friendly, laid-back Tahitian ambiance. The Resort has enough modern conveniences for today's travellers to be comfortable, without losing the traditional Polynesian atmosphere of living in harmony with nature.

Although there are frequent
international flights into Tahiti, there are limited airports of
embarkation to choose from, with currently only Paris, Los Angeles,
Auckland and Tokyo offering single plane air service to
Tahiti.
The international airline for French Polynesia. is Air Tahiti
Nui, who operate daily flights from Paris and Los
Angeles to Tahiti, and on some days there are additional fights
to/from Los Angeles. In addition, they operate two weekly flights
to/from Auckland and they serve Tokyo twice a week. Their services
to New York and Sydney have been suspended, at this
time.
Air France
currently offer a service from Paris, three times a week via Los
Angeles
Air New Zealand
operates daily flights via LA to Papeete, and 5 days a week from/to
Auckland with it's own aircraft. It also operates a codeshare
arrangements with Air Tahiti Nui providing seats on their fights
from Tahiti to Auckland and Los Angeles.
United Airlines operate 3 times
a week from San Francisco to Papeete, on Tuesday, Thursday and
Sunday, which will connect to their daily flight from
Heathrow.
Air Calin
operate a weekly flight between Noumea, in New Caledonia, and
Tahiti.
Hawaiian
Airlines provide a weekly service between Honolulu and
Tahiti, currently operating on a Saturday/Sunday schedule.
LANChile
operate a flight once a week from Santiago to Tahiti via
Easter Island, providing the availability to do a great side trip
from Tahiti to Easter island.
Air Tahiti is
French Polynesia's domestic airline, which operates an extensive
domestic flight network covering all the country's main islands,
with at least a daily service. With the main Society islands
receiving a number of flights a day, since Air Moorea stopped
operations between Tahiti and Moorea, the flight connections now to
Moorea have become limited, most connections between the two are
now done by ferry boat.
The less populated and outer islands have a restricted service, so
sometimes a night stop in Tahiti may be required when connecting to
these islands.
Air Tahiti
provide the only air service between Tahiti and the Cook islands,
which they currently do once a week on a Thursday, an extra high
season flight is operated between June and August
There are a number of aircraft and helicopters available for private charters, but they all tend to be based in Tahiti so arranging charters between the outer islands can be expensive as the aircraft will originate and terminate in Tahiti.
